Why Tivimate users need a VPN
- Tivimate can pull streams from many providers, some of which may be geo-restricted or unreliable without a VPN.
- A VPN hides your traffic from ISPs and helps prevent throttling during peak hours.
- It adds an extra layer of privacy, which is especially important when you’re trying multiple streaming sources.

How to test VPN performance for Tivimate
- Step-by-step quick test:
- Connect to a server in your target region
- Open Tivimate and load a streaming channel
- Check for buffering time and video quality
- Switch to a closer server if you get lag
- Repeat across several servers to find the best balance between speed and access
- Real-world tips:
- If you’re streaming 1080p, aim for 20-40 Mbps per stream
- For 4K, look for 60 Mbps or higher
- Use servers near your source for best latency

Troubleshooting common Tivimate + VPN issues
- Issue: Video stuttering
- Solution: Switch to a closer VPN server, reduce video resolution, or check network speed.
- Issue: Unable to access certain channels
- Solution: Try a different server in the same region, clear app data, or contact VPN support.
- Issue: VPN disconnects frequently
- Solution: Enable the kill switch, switch to a more stable server, or update the app.

What is Tivimate?
Tivimate is a powerful IPTV player that aggregates streams from many sources. It lets you organize and view playlists and channels from various providers.
Do I really need a VPN for Tivimate?
If you want to protect your privacy, avoid throttling, and access geo-blocked channels, a VPN is highly beneficial for Tivimate use.
